Rocket girls basketball team suffer first loss of the season


PhotoNews Media/Clark Brooks
Unity's Katey Moore and Clinton's MaKayla Koeppel fight for ball possession in the second of their non-conference game in the Rocket Center on Monday. Moore and the Rockets (4-1) suffered their first loss of the season, dropping the home opener 38-20 in front of a small, but supportive crowd to the visiting Maroons (4-1). Next, Unity goes on the road to take on Cissna Park this evening.
